Caulcott emerges from the flat, industrious horizon of the Marston Vale like a quiet thought held in a landscape of clay and water. It lies 3.3 miles north-west of Ampthill (from Ampthill: bearing 322°T, OS grid TL 000 422), and is situated south-south-east of Lower Shelton village. The light here catches the surface of Stewartby Lake, a mere half-mile to the east, casting long, fractured glimmers across the fields that seem to amplify the stillness of the afternoon. Caulcott remains defined by its proximity to the Marston Vale, where the earth bears the heavy, persistent memory of brick-making and the slow reclamation of nature. To the south-south-east, the waters of The Pillinge reflect the shifting grey of the Bedfordshire sky, turning the horizon into a blurred seam of slate and cloud.
